typedef struct ole2_header_tag
{
unsigned char magic[8]; /* should be: 0xd0cf11e0a1b11ae1 */
unsigned char clsid[16];
uint16_t minor_version __attribute__ ((packed));
uint16_t dll_version __attribute__ ((packed));
int16_t byte_order __attribute__ ((packed)); /* -2=intel */
uint16_t log2_big_block_size __attribute__ ((packed)); /* usually 9 (2^9 = 512) */
uint32_t log2_small_block_size __attribute__ ((packed)); /* usually 6 (2^6 = 64) */
int32_t reserved[2] __attribute__ ((packed));
int32_t bat_count __attribute__ ((packed));
int32_t prop_start __attribute__ ((packed));
uint32_t signature __attribute__ ((packed));
uint32_t sbat_cutoff __attribute__ ((packed)); /* cutoff for files held in small blocks (4096) */
int32_t sbat_start __attribute__ ((packed));
int32_t sbat_block_count __attribute__ ((packed));
int32_t xbat_start __attribute__ ((packed));
int32_t xbat_count __attribute__ ((packed));
int32_t bat_array[109] __attribute__ ((packed));
/* not part of the ole2 header, but stuff we need in order to decode */
/* must take account of the size of variables below here when
reading the header */
int32_t sbat_root_start __attribute__ ((packed));
uint32_t max_block_no;
unsigned char *m_area;
off_t m_length;
bitset_t *bitset;
struct uniq *U;
int has_vba;
} ole2_header_t;
typedef struct property_tag
{
char name[64]; /* in unicode */
uint16_t name_size __attribute__ ((packed));
unsigned char type; /* 1=dir 2=file 5=root */
unsigned char color; /* black or red */
uint32_t prev __attribute__ ((packed));
uint32_t next __attribute__ ((packed));
uint32_t child __attribute__ ((packed));
unsigned char clsid[16];
uint32_t user_flags __attribute__ ((packed));
uint32_t create_lowdate __attribute__ ((packed));
uint32_t create_highdate __attribute__ ((packed));
uint32_t mod_lowdate __attribute__ ((packed));
uint32_t mod_highdate __attribute__ ((packed));
uint32_t start_block __attribute__ ((packed));
uint32_t size __attribute__ ((packed));
unsigned char reserved[4];
} property_t;
#ifdef HAVE_PRAGMA_PACK
#pragma pack()
#endif
#ifdef HAVE_PRAGMA_PACK_HPPA
#pragma pack
#endif
static unsigned char magic_id[] = { 0xd0, 0xcf, 0x11, 0xe0, 0xa1, 0xb1, 0x1a, 0xe1};

static int ole2_read_block(int fd, ole2_header_t *hdr, void *buff, unsigned int size, int32_t blockno)
{
off_t offset, offend;
if (blockno < 0) {
return FALSE;
}
/* other methods: (blockno+1) * 512 or (blockno * block_size) + 512; */
offset = (blockno << hdr->log2_big_block_size) + MAX(512, 1 << hdr->log2_big_block_size); /* 512 is header size */
if (hdr->m_area == NULL) {
if (lseek(fd, offset, SEEK_SET) != offset) {
return FALSE;
}
if (cli_readn(fd, buff, size) != size) {
return FALSE;
}
} else {
offend = offset + size;
if ((offend <= 0) || (offend > hdr->m_length)) {
return FALSE;
}
memcpy(buff, hdr->m_area+offset, size);
}
return TRUE;
}
static int32_t ole2_get_next_bat_block(int fd, ole2_header_t *hdr, int32_t current_block)
{
int32_t bat_array_index;
uint32_t bat[128];
if (current_block < 0) {
return -1;
}
bat_array_index = current_block / 128;
if (bat_array_index > hdr->bat_count) {
cli_dbgmsg("bat_array index error\n");
return -10;
}
if (!ole2_read_block(fd, hdr, &bat, 512,
ole2_endian_convert_32(hdr->bat_array[bat_array_index]))) {
return -1;
}
return ole2_endian_convert_32(bat[current_block-(bat_array_index * 128)]);
}
static int32_t ole2_get_next_xbat_block(int fd, ole2_header_t *hdr, int32_t current_block)
{
int32_t xbat_index, xbat_block_index, bat_index, bat_blockno;
uint32_t xbat[128], bat[128];
if (current_block < 0) {
return -1;
}
xbat_index = current_block / 128;
/* NB: The last entry in each XBAT points to the next XBAT block.
This reduces the number of entries in each block by 1.
*/
xbat_block_index = (xbat_index - 109) / 127;
bat_blockno = (xbat_index - 109) % 127;
bat_index = current_block % 128;
if (!ole2_read_block(fd, hdr, &xbat, 512, hdr->xbat_start)) {
return -1;
}
/* Follow the chain of XBAT blocks */
while (xbat_block_index > 0) {
if (!ole2_read_block(fd, hdr, &xbat, 512,
ole2_endian_convert_32(xbat[127]))) {
return -1;
}
xbat_block_index--;
}
if (!ole2_read_block(fd, hdr, &bat, 512, ole2_endian_convert_32(xbat[bat_blockno]))) {
return -1;
}
return ole2_endian_convert_32(bat[bat_index]);
}
static int32_t ole2_get_next_block_number(int fd, ole2_header_t *hdr, int32_t current_block)
{
if (current_block < 0) {
return -1;
}
if ((current_block / 128) > 108) {
return ole2_get_next_xbat_block(fd, hdr, current_block);
} else {
return ole2_get_next_bat_block(fd, hdr, current_block);
}
}
static int32_t ole2_get_next_sbat_block(int fd, ole2_header_t *hdr, int32_t current_block)
{
int32_t iter, current_bat_block;
uint32_t sbat[128];
if (current_block < 0) {
return -1;
}
current_bat_block = hdr->sbat_start;
iter = current_block / 128;
while (iter > 0) {
current_bat_block = ole2_get_next_block_number(fd, hdr, current_bat_block);
iter--;
}
if (!ole2_read_block(fd, hdr, &sbat, 512, current_bat_block)) {
return -1;
}
return ole2_endian_convert_32(sbat[current_block % 128]);
}
/* Retrieve the block containing the data for the given sbat index */
static int32_t ole2_get_sbat_data_block(int fd, ole2_header_t *hdr, void *buff, int32_t sbat_index)
{
int32_t block_count, current_block;
if (sbat_index < 0) {
return FALSE;
}
if (hdr->sbat_root_start < 0) {
cli_errmsg("No root start block\n");
return FALSE;
}
block_count = sbat_index / (1 << (hdr->log2_big_block_size - hdr->log2_small_block_size));
current_block = hdr->sbat_root_start;
while (block_count > 0) {
current_block = ole2_get_next_block_number(fd, hdr, current_block);
block_count--;
}
/* current_block now contains the block number of the sbat array
containing the entry for the required small block */
return(ole2_read_block(fd, hdr, buff, 1 << hdr->log2_big_block_size, current_block));
}
